Steel shot is a push beyond 40 yards. It patterns better with an open choke and will kill consistantly inside of 40 yards. There is no use trying to argue about being a "better shot" with me. Good post Fish and Willmac. If most of you need anything more than a modified, you are probably a skybuster and don't even know it. I guess it depends on what you call skybusting though, I call it shooting at a bird that you will not kill cleanly 75% of the time or better. For me, anything over 35yrds is too far as I like to shoot birds that are called in and not just passing by. Most of our shots are 10 to 15yrds. Just my preference though.
